_**Job Scope**:_
As VP, Development you are responsible for all Development-related matters. You will oversee and supervise the development activities of all projects (including high-rise multi-family, low-rise wood-frame structures, office towers and other misc. project), provide leadership and cost insights to the land and property acquisitions process, and provide effective management to the various consultants the Company engages. Your internal and external circles include Development Managers, Design & Development functions, external Consultants, City Officers and oversee all aspects of projects throughout the various phases of development, across multiple projects simultaneously. In this role, you will use your management skills, leadership experience, collaboration, networking, and entrepreneurial skills to spearhead the growth and development of the department and the team including project managers, development managers, development coordinators. You will also work alongside senior leadership to continue expanding their portfolio of work in this sector and support organization-wide initiatives. VP Development will work closely with various departments and teams, internally and externally, to shape and strengthen the processes related to the acquisition, planning, design, and development, including coordinating, and managing consultants.
**Corporate Leadership role**:Being in a leadership role in the company:
a. You will participate in regular strategy formulation processes and annual target setting process for the Company.
b. You will play a role in building the Keltic team and designing incentive schemes for the Company’s long-term goals and participate in assessing the performances of key middle management members. Prepare the next generation of leaders for the Company’s future.
c. You are also expected to play a leadership role in shaping the Company’s corporate culture of Accountability and Commitment, Effective Cost Control, Efficiency, Continuous Learning and Innovation, Business Conducts. You lead by demonstration and being a role model.
**Functional Responsibility**:
This role will encompass and collaboratively work with the entire development process from due diligence, planning, design, scheduling and budgeting, approvals, to implementation and completion. Participate in verifying detailed project proformas and cashflows throughout the development cycles.
1. Assist with analysis, determining and making recommendations on the feasibility of multiple projects and contribute creatively with “out-of-the box” thinking to max out the value of an existing property.
2. Strong experience working in leadership, managing, and mentoring teams, guiding multiple projects through conception, design development, and completion.
3. Proficient in preparation and review of development proformas, with a sharp sense of current industry cost information.
4. Manage cost estimates prior to and during development.
5. Project reporting to the Shareholders including the creation and execution of development business plans.
6. Will be proactive in working closely with Keltic’s internal team as well as external consultants in delivering successful projects from re-zoning to completion. Responsibilities would include negotiating with cities and municipalities, the design approval and delivery of permits thereby improving the financial performance of all development projects.
7. Determining and making recommendations on the feasibility of multiple projects and ensuring that project requirements of scope, scheduling, budget, and design quality are being managed properly throughout the project life cycle.
8. Negotiate legal agreements with various consultants, contractors, and city managers.
a. Work collaboratively with the project team including construction, design, and marketing.
9. Assist Acquisitions Department during due diligence process and lead on environmentally sensitive and contaminated sites, communicate with environmental consultants, and support the remediation process.
11. Attend legal public engagement activities and being part of the public interface of Keltic with the different communities.
12. Establish network of contacts within the municipal, consultant and development communities.
